Barron Trump is one of the most famous teens in the United States. Before he became one of the nation's First Kids, he was the son of a popular American personality, with his growth documented by photographers in all manner of locations.
This Monday, Barron supportedDonald Trump as he was inaugurated for his second term as President. Trump first entered the White House in 2017, with Barron residing in the historic building between the ages of 10 to 14. He was the first boy to live in the home since John F. Kennedy Jr.

Barron has been a part of Donald Trump's entire presidency. He supported his dad in January, 2017, wearing a suit and a blue tie as his father was sworn in as the 45th President of the United States.
In 2009, Melania and Barron attended the annual Bunny Hop event hosted in New York, conducted to benefit the Society of Memorial-Sloan Kettering Cancer Center.
